FGPI_CTL[3:2] == 00 or 01
fgpi_buf_sync sampled during last record of buffer #1
will allow the record to finish being loaded into buffer #1
FGPI_CTL[3:2] == 10
fgpi_buf_sync sampled before last record of buffer #1
will switch to buffer #2 after storing the last sample in
buffer #1. Subsequent samples will be saved in buffer
#2. Note: the rest of buffer #1 is undefined.
fgpi_buf_sync sampled during last record of buffer #1
will switch to buffer #2 after storing the last sample in
buffer #1. Subsequent samples will be saved in buffer
#2. Note: the rest of buffer #1 is undefined.
FGPI_CTL[3:2] == 00 or 01
fgpi_buf_sync sampled before last record of buffer #1
will allow the record to finish being loaded into buffer#1
but record n will be loaded into buffer #2. Note: the rest
of buffer #1 is undefined.
FGPI_CTL[3:2] == 10
